CSS拉伸背景圖片是一種常見的網頁設計技術,通過使用CSS屬性,可以將背景圖片拉伸到網頁的任意位置,同時保持圖片的大小不變。這項技術可以幫助設計師在網頁設計中更加靈活地使用圖片,同時也可以提高網頁的可讀性和美觀度。
1. background-size: cover;
這個屬性表示將圖片拉伸到整個頁面,并且不會留下任何裁剪區域。cover表示將圖片拉伸到頁面的每個角落,并且不留下任何邊框或邊界。
2. background-size: contain;
這個屬性表示將圖片拉伸到頁面的任意角落,但是會留下一個拉伸出來的邊框。 contain表示拉伸出來的邊框大小與圖片的大小相等,并且不會重疊。
3. background-size: no-repeat;
這個屬性表示圖片不會重復出現,只會在頁面中拉伸。no-repeat表示圖片不會重復出現,但是會按照指定的方向進行旋轉。
通過以上三個屬性的組合使用,設計師可以輕松地將背景圖片拉伸到網頁的任意位置,并且保持圖片的大小不變。同時,還可以通過CSS的旋轉和裁剪等功能,進一步調整圖片的布局和呈現效果。
需要注意的是,使用CSS拉伸背景圖片可能會導致圖片的兼容性問題。因此,在設計網頁時,需要確保瀏覽器支持CSS拉伸背景圖片的屬性,并且選擇適合當前網絡環境的的圖片路徑和名稱。
CSS拉伸背景圖片是一項非常有用的網頁設計技術,可以幫助設計師更加靈活地使用圖片,提高網頁的可讀性和美觀度。